    摘要:

    目的 探究芭克硅胶软膏与点阵CO2激光联合治疗对烧伤后增生性瘢痕患者瘢痕改善情况的影 响。方法 选取2023年9月-2024年7月浏阳市金阳医院治疗的70例烧伤后增生性瘢痕患者,采取随机数字表 法将患者分为对照组和观察组,每组35例。对照组予以点阵CO2激光治疗,观察组予以点阵CO2激光联合 芭克硅胶软膏治疗。比较两组瘢痕严重程度、瘢痕厚度及瘢痕增生相关因子。结果 两组治疗后VSS各维 度评分及总分低于治疗前,且与对照组比较,观察组治疗后VSS各维度评分及总分更低(P <0.05); 观察组治疗后瘢痕厚度为(2.58±0.41)mm,小于对照组的(4.52±0.33)mm(P <0.05);两组治疗 后EGF、TGF-β1、VEGF水平低于治疗前,且与对照组比较,观察组治疗后EGF、TGF-β1、VEGF水 平更低(P <0.05)。结论 对烧伤后增生性瘢痕患者采取芭克硅胶软膏联合点阵CO2激光治疗能够减轻瘢 痕严重程度,改善瘢痕厚度,调节瘢痕生长因子,值得临床应用。

    Abstract:

    Objective To explore the effect of Kelo-Cote silicone gel combined with fractional CO2 laser on scar improvement in patients with hypertrophic scar after burn. Methods A total of 70 patients with hypertrophic scar after burn treated in Liuyang Jinyang Hospital from September 2023 to July 2024 were selected. According to the random number table method, they were divided into the control group and the observation group, with 35 patients in each group. The control group was treated with fractional CO2 laser, and the observation group was treated with Kelo-Cote silicone gel combined with fractional CO2 laser. The scar severity, scar thickness and hypertrophic scar related factors were compared between the two groups. Results After treatment, the scores of each dimension and the total score of VSS in the two groups were lower than those before treatment, and the scores of each dimension and the total score of VSS in the observation group after treatment were lower than those in the control group (P <0.05). The scar thickness in the observation group after treatment was (2.58±0.41) mm, which was lower than (4.52±0.33) mm in the control group (P <0.05). After treatment, the levels of EGF, TGF-β1 and VEGF in the two groups were lower than those before treatment, and the levels of EGF, TGF-β1 and VEGF in the observation group after treatment were lower than those in the control group (P <0.05). Conclusion For patients with hypertrophic scar after burn, Kelo-Cote silicone gel combined with fractional CO2 laser can reduce the scar severity, improve the scar thickness, and regulate the scar growth factors, which is worthy of clinical application.
